About the School

  • The mission of Melmark is to serve children, adults and their families affected by a broad range of developmental disabilities.
  • We provide evidence-based, educational, vocational, clinical, residential, healthcare and rehabilitative services, personally designed for each individual in an environment of warmth, care and respect.
  • Our goal is to help each individual served have a meaningful life and attain the highest possible level of personal growth and achievement.
  • We strive to develop the intellectual, emotional, social and physical aspects of each individual by providing a wide range of activities, opportunities and challenges.
  • We partner with families to define and implement appropriate goals for each child or adult served.
